Understanding the Idea of an Acre: How Many Toes In One Acer

An acre is a unit of space generally used to measure land, with one acre equal to 43,560 sq. toes. This idea performs a big position in understanding geographical and mathematical implications in real-world eventualities, reminiscent of land measurement and space calculations.The idea of an acre has its roots within the early English system of measurement, which was influenced by the traditional Romans and used to measure land and different properties.

This technique has undergone important modifications and evolution over the centuries, reflecting developments in measurement and surveying practices.

Q: What’s the relationship between an acre and toes?

A: An acre is the same as 43,560 sq. toes, making it a elementary unit of land measurement. Correct conversions between acreage measurements and toes are important for varied industries.

Q: How is an acre historically outlined?

A: An acre was historically outlined as an space of land that may be plowed by one yoke of oxen in a day. Whereas this definition is now not broadly used at the moment, it highlights the historic significance of this measurement.
